#7e3038 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e3038 is composed of 49.4% red, 18.8%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.9% magenta, 55.6%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 353.8 degrees, a saturation of 44.8% and a lightness of 34.1%. #7e3038 color hex could be obtained by blending #fc6070 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#7e3038 color description : Dark moderate red.
#7e3038 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e3038 has RGB values of R:126, G:48,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.56,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8269880.
